Bohr radius [b, a.u.]
Definition: The Bohr radius is a unit of length equal to approximately 5.29177 x 10^-11 meters.
Historyandorigin: It was introduced by Niels Bohr in the early 20th century.
CurrentUse: It is used in atomic physics and quantum mechanics.
funfact: The Bohr radius is the most probable distance between the proton and electron in a hydrogen atom.
handbreadth
Definition: A handbreadth is a unit of length equal to approximately 3 inches or 7.62 centimeters.
Historyandorigin: It has historical origins in ancient Near Eastern measurements.
CurrentUse: It is rarely used in modern times but can be found in historical contexts.
funfact: The handbreadth was based on the width of a hand.
